The project involves the construction of the 1st Street Raccoon River Trail in West Des Moines, Iowa. Bids must be submitted electronically by January 21, 2026, at 2:00 PM CT. A physical copy of the bid security is required within 48 hours of the bid deadline. Work must commence within ten days of the written notice and be completed by September 30th, 2026. Liquidated damages of **** per day will be assessed for delays. Payment will be made based on monthly estimates, with final payment according to Iowa statutes and contract documents.
The work must be completed by September 30th, 2026, as stated in the bid notice.
Payment will be made based on monthly estimates in amounts equal to ninety-seven 97 percent of the contract value of the work completed during the preceding calendar month, and will be based upon an estimate prepared by the contractor on the first day of the month, subject to the approval of the engineer, as stated in the bid notice.
The successful bidder will be required to furnish a performance and payment bond in the amount of one hundred percent 100 of the contract price guaranteeing faithful performance of the contract and guaranteeing payment to all persons supplying labor andor materials in the execution of the work provided for in the contract, as stated in the bid notice.
The award of the contract will be made to the lowest responsibleresponsive bidder with the lowest bid being determined by the lowest base bid, exclusive of any alternates, allowances, or unit prices, as stated in the bid notice.
Failure to submit a fully completed bidder status form with the bid may result in the bid being deemed nonresponsive and rejected, as stated in the bid notice.
Liquidated damages in the amount of two hundred fifty dollars **** per day will be assessed for each day that the work remains uncompleted after the end of the contract period, as stated in the bid notice.
